Memory care in Crown Point offers 24-hour care and supervision, trained staff, and specialized activities to accommodate the needs of seniors with Alzheimer’s or dementia. These communities typically offer advanced security features and engaging activities to help ensure residents’ well-being. The cost of memory care in Crown Point is about $4,491 per month. Cost of memory care in Crown Point, FL

The average cost of senior living in Crown Point is $4,491 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Groveland, FL with an average of $4,418 per month.
